Webb4 apr. 2024 · If your stainless steel looks old and dull, then this technique will be helpful for you to bring back the shine. In a bowl add 2 tablespoons of baking soda and squeeze in fresh lemon juice. With the help of a sponge, apply this paste evenly on the utensils and set it aside for 10-15 minutes. Rinse it with warm water and admire your shiny utensils. Webb23 juli 2024 · There are a few different ways that you can remove stains from stainless steel surfaces. Webb1 nov. 2024 · Dip a damp sponge into dry baking soda, and use it to scrub away any bits of food that remain. Add some white vinegar to the paste while it's on the pan to create a bubbling action that can loosen the burnt-on food. Rinse well, and dry the cookware. If the food does not come off easily, sprinkle the bottom of the pan liberally with baking soda ...
